Output d3fec629cb3320a6a48822a63f7f22536e355141890f53428a94a633c5fa2176:18
- value
- 636000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 874bf166be18562de279592f37651a526fe9026f OP_EQUAL
- address
- 3E2Q83vUvGyRUV39Kd8oHSiJgMkF7oAYAK
- transaction
- d3fec629cb3320a6a48822a63f7f22536e355141890f53428a94a633c5fa2176
- confirmations
- 131241
- spent
- true